ANSI B109.3 Rotary Gas Displacement Meters, this standard provides a basic standard for operation, robust and durable construction, and acceptable performance for rotary gas displacement meters. This work is the result of years of experience supported by extensive research. The standard aims to meet minimum design, material, performance and testing requirements for efficient use of rotary displacement meters.
